Output ab66237201f18934c7456f4a15542613c1e784a886a30f2c73e32931e7050c6d:26

value
573600
script pubkey
OP_0 OP_PUSHBYTES_20 22e690c6837ce99404d5ae78e555be7b5cbdb117
address
bc1qytnfp35r0n5egpx44euw24d70dwtmvgh035ggx
transaction
ab66237201f18934c7456f4a15542613c1e784a886a30f2c73e32931e7050c6d